Background
Music in the Vineyards is the Napa Valley’s longest running Chamber Music Festival. Founded in 1995, it has grown to be one of Napa’s premier cultural events and continues to lead the way in the presentation of outstanding music performance. The Festival is unique in its ability to host concerts of international scale featuring the world’s most highly regarded artists while also highlighting Napa’s winery venues.

Job Summary

Music in the Vineyards is currently undergoing a re-design of our website and alongside this we aim to build and establish a robust social media presence, particularly during the Festival in August.  The Festival is also expanding our community activities with accessible concerts, family events and the continuation of our Fellowship String Quartet Program (FSQ).  The FSQ is resident during the festival and give a program of free performances throughout the Napa Valley community for all age groups.  Reporting to the Executive Director, MITV’s Social Media and Community Outreach Coordinator will work with the artistic directors and musicians to establish and implement a calendar of social media activity. Alongside this the Coordinator will maintain and build on community contacts and schedule the activities of the FSQ prior to the Festival.  In a small office, the Social Media /Community Outreach Coordinator will work closely with the other staff and will be fully involved and supported in all aspects of the role.  Candidates for this position must be able to fulfill a flexible work schedule with occasional weekend and evening hours particularly during the Festival in August.
